Abstract
This paper is concerned with iterative learning control of Hamiltonian systems, which is applicable to electro-mechanical systems. We propose a new learning control scheme based on the self-adjoint structure of the variational of those systems. This method dose not require precise information about target systems such as the physical parameters of those systems. And we demonstrate the effectiveness of the proposed method by experiments.
